  • In the world of interior design, design firm principals are constantly juggling a million and one tasks. From design discovery to client onboarding, floor plans to renderings, networking to social media, project management to client care, you do it all. Let’s face it, you’re wearing upwards of 36 hats at any one time, and it can leave you feeling overwhelmed and under-earning. And that leaves less time and energy for the activities that bring you real profit. EARN MORE WHILE DOING WHAT YOU LOVE You started your business to make money, doing what you love…design. Many designers are so bogged down with low-dollar tasks, that their finances and creativity both take a hit. If you want to increase your profit and engage in the work you love doing, then you must start focusing your efforts on the right activities. I remind my clients, “Where your focus goes, your finances flow.” In today’s episode, you’ll learn how to distinguish between high-dollar and low-dollar tasks, so you can prioritize activities that directly contribute to your profit. While low-dollar tasks are necessary activities within your business that must be completed, they are not a priority. As a designer and business owner, you should focus on tasks that impact your bottom line and require higher levels of expertise and skill. The categories here can make it simpler: lead generation and marketing, SEO and visibility, sales and offers, creative work, project management, communication, and admin. You only have a finite amount of time. Knowing where your time is going each day will make a big difference. Let’s find out where you’re spending your time, so we can make you more money! You’ll learn how to dollarize your days, so you earn more in every activity. And you can delegate low dollar tasks. Your time as principal designer, Creative Director, or CEO is best invested in $1k tasks vs. the many $100 and $10 that can be delegated to team or outsourcing online. DELEGATE TO INCREASE PROFITS & AVOID BURNOUT When you stay focused on your Zone of Genius work at least 80% of the time, you’ll find yourself more productive, more fulfilled and more profitable. It’s vital that you relinquish the idea that you must do it all yourself. This is a myth and a costly one. Instead, when you assign a dollar value to each task, you’ll find that by delegating what you aren’t efficient at, what you don’t love, and what isn’t impacting the bottom line directly, that more gets done and you step out of sacrifice and off the burn out path. Your firm will earn more with the right team in place. Whenever you can outsource or delegate to someone who is a fraction of your hourly rate (internal use only, you know I advocate flat fees) you get time back for the actions that matter most.
